How Law Firms Can Build A Thriving Referral Network

Referrals serve as a cornerstone for success in the legal profession, both in attracting new clients and affirming one’s credibility and expertise. To cultivate a thriving practice through referrals, lawyers must employ effective strategies that focus on building and maintaining strong professional relationships, according to an article by DRI.

It’s probably no surprise that delivering exceptional service to existing clients is paramount. By consistently going above and beyond, communicating effectively, and ensuring client satisfaction throughout their legal journey, lawyers can earn the trust and loyalty needed for referrals.

Beyond that, networking strategically plays a pivotal role. Attending industry events, legal conferences, and local business gatherings provides opportunities to connect with colleagues and professionals in various practice areas. Cultivating genuine relationships beyond simply exchanging business cards expands referral sources and strengthens the referral network.

In today’s digital age, online platforms like LinkedIn offer a powerful tool for lawyers to showcase their expertise, share valuable content, and engage with peers and potential clients. Positive interactions and active participation in online communities can lead to referrals from both clients and fellow professionals.

Another way to build referrals is by encouraging satisfied clients to provide testimonials and reviews that serve as social proof of a lawyer’s skills and reliability. Displaying these testimonials prominently on websites and marketing materials instills confidence in potential clients and reinforces the value of referrals.

Establishing oneself as an authority in a specific niche area of law through educational content, such as blog posts and webinars, not only attracts clients but also garners referrals from other legal professionals seeking expertise in that particular field.

By cultivating relationships with professionals outside the legal sphere, such as accountants and real estate agents, lawyers can tap into additional referral sources. Expressing gratitude promptly for referrals reinforces appreciation and encourages continued recommendations.

Ultimately, specializing in a niche area of law sets lawyers apart and increases the likelihood of receiving referrals for similar cases. Collectively, these strategies contribute to building a robust referral network and ensuring long-term success in the legal profession.
